php查看错误信息用哪个函数 PHP程序中怎么解决“未定义的索引”这个问题?

[更新]
·
·
分类:互联网
2055 阅读

php查看错误信息用哪个函数

PHP程序中怎么解决“未定义的索引”这个问题?

PHP程序中怎么解决“未定义的索引”这个问题?

通常出现未定义的索引问题是由于数组没有这个值造成的,数组分为关联数组和索引数组,索引数组是数字下标;关联数组是键值下标。
$POST[id]之所以报未定义索引是因为$POST这个数组里没有包含下标键值为id的值。
解决办法: 判断数组中是否包含下标键值为id的值,如果没有,则返回错误信息,如何判断呢,最简单的方法就是用函数isset来判断,如isset($POST[id]),存在则返回true,反之则为false
三元判断法,不存在给一个默认的数值, 如 $POST[id] isset($POST[id])?$POST[id]:

php程序一般怎么打log?

php没有log这个函数,一般都是手动使用echo来输出想要的数据. 另外可以开启php自身的输出,不过只能自动输出,提示,警告和错误

本地测试ok,上传阿里云虚拟空间后查询结果不显示,需要开启什么函数,php空间?

如题,设计一个数据查询程序,是excel中xls格式,本地测试ok。上传阿里云虚拟空间后,输出结果不显示,连底部内容也不显示了。请问改开启什么函数,谢谢!本地测试是phpStudy配置环境。源码源自

需要确定你的php,apache服务器和mysql 是否成功安装并开启,还有,php的mysql 扩展在后面的版本中已经被废弃。可以使用mysqli 扩展和pdo 扩展,不显示应该是数据库操作失败,可以echo一个mysqli _error 和mysqli_ erron 查看错误编码和信息,再进行调试。

php404错误解决方法?

简单修正方法:
1、Internet 服务管理器---网站(右键)---属性---主目录---配置---添加---扩展名为 .php ,单击“浏览”将可执行文件指向 php5isapi.dll 所在路径,如:D:phpphp5isapi.dll
2、Internet 服务管理器---Web 信息管理器---添加一个新的web扩展程序---输入:PHP ,再将可执行文件指向 php5isapi.dll 所在路径---允许
3、将以下代码复制到一个文本文件内,保存为.bat文件 并运行
1
2
3
net stop w3svc
net stop iisadmin
net start w3svc
4、新建一个网站 在网站目录下建立 内容为
1
2
3
lt?
phpinfo()
?gt
如果不行的话就重新安装下PHP吧。